專注和簡單一直是我的秘訣之一,簡單的事情可能比復雜更難做到,你必須努力理清思路,從而使其便的簡單;但這最終是值得的,因為你一旦做到了,便可創造奇跡。 ---喬布斯 #刪除所有數據 delete from user; #重置 ...
問題背景: 在使用數據庫時,經常要使用主鍵,並設置其為自增字段,我使用的初衷是想要數據庫自動給我分配一個空閑的ID給我使用,但是使用后發現,如果我們刪除數據后,后面添加的數據的自增ID始終是在之前的基礎上開始的,我想要的自增字段始終從 開始。 在多次插入數據后,自增的ID號比較混亂,而且刪除數據后,自增的ID並不會歸零,經過多方查閱,了解到有兩種方法可以控制自增的字段: 方法一: 如果曾經的數據都 ...
2018-11-23 11:31 0 2987 推薦指數:
專注和簡單一直是我的秘訣之一,簡單的事情可能比復雜更難做到,你必須努力理清思路,從而使其便的簡單;但這最終是值得的,因為你一旦做到了,便可創造奇跡。 ---喬布斯 #刪除所有數據 delete from user; #重置 ...
分類專欄: 數據庫 轉:https://blog.csdn.net/chineseyoung/article/details/79277767 方法一(效率高,謹慎使用): 清空表數據並重置id: truncate table table_name; 注意 ...
...
測試數據因為表自增的關系清空后id並不會重置為1,所以需要重置自增id 語句 即可 ...
sql語句:truncate tablename; 會清空表的所有記錄,並且使自增的id重置。 另外,navicat的截斷表,就是這個功能。 它的清空表只會清空數據,不能使自增的id重置。 ...
ID歸1語句:truncate table users --刪除表全部數據,然后從1開始自增 ID重置(保留內容)語句:DBCC CHECKIDENT (users,reseed,0) 轉自:http://wnsfl.blog.163.com/blog/static ...
mysql清空表數據並重置自增ID: ## 查看mysql> select * from work_order_company;mysql> show create table work_order_company; ## 清除mysql> delete from ...
如果你有一張表,你的主鍵是ID,然后由於測來測去的原因,你的ID不是從1開始連續的自增了。 終於有一天,使用這張表的某個系統要導入正式數據了,強迫症這時候就表現的明顯了,渾身不自在, 這時候你就需要將這個主鍵ID重置一波了,方法是在這張表中新增一個字段,將ID里面的數據復制過去, 然后刪除 ...